Vinyl Floor Replacement in Boulder, CO
Vinyl floor replacement services involve removing existing flooring and installing new vinyl surfaces in residential properties. This process is commonly requested for kitchens, bathrooms, laundry rooms, or any area where durable, water-resistant flooring is desired. Property owners often seek this service to update the look of a space, repair damaged flooring, or improve functionality. Before requesting vinyl floor replacement, homeowners should consider the condition of the subfloor, the style and thickness of vinyl options available, and any specific requirements related to moisture resistance or ease of maintenance.
It is important for property owners to understand the scope of the project, including the preparation needed for a smooth installation and the types of vinyl flooring that best suit their needs. Questions about the removal of old flooring, the levelness of the subfloor, and the finishing details are common. Clear communication about expectations and the desired outcome can help ensure the replacement process aligns with the property’s aesthetic and functional goals.

Vinyl Floor Replacement Questions
What are common reasons to replace vinyl flooring? Vinyl flooring may need replacement due to wear, damage, or outdated styles that no longer match the space’s look.
Can vinyl flooring be installed over existing floors? Yes, in many cases, vinyl can be installed over existing flooring if the surface is smooth and in good condition.
What types of projects typically involve vinyl floor replacement? Projects include remodeling kitchens, bathrooms, basements, or updating commercial spaces with new vinyl flooring.
What should property owners consider before replacing vinyl flooring? It's important to assess the current subfloor condition, choose the right vinyl type, and plan for proper surface preparation.
